Common heating installation types and issues in La Habra homes

  • High-efficiency gas furnaces: preferred where reliable combustion heat and fast warm-up are desired. Common issues on replacement: incorrect venting, undersized flue, or incompatible furnace cabinets in tight mechanical closets.
  • Heat pumps (air-source): excellent for Southern California’s mild winters and provide year-round heating and cooling. Common issues: improper refrigerant charge, insufficient outdoor unit clearance, and mismatched indoor coil capacity.
  • Ductless mini-split systems: ideal for room additions, garages, or homes without central ductwork. Issues often stem from mis-sited indoor heads or inadequate line-set routing.
  • Ductwork problems: leaks, undersizing, poor insulation in attics, and unbalanced registers are frequent causes of poor heating performance even after a new unit is installed.

What a professional site survey and load calculation includes

  • On-site assessment of the home’s envelope: insulation levels, window orientation, air leakage, and attic conditions relevant to La Habra’s climate.
  • Detailed heat load calculation (Manual J) to determine proper equipment capacity. This prevents oversized systems that short-cycle or undersized systems that struggle on cool nights.
  • Ductwork evaluation (Manual D) to identify leaks, improper routing, or the need for resizing, sealing, or additional returns.
  • Electrical and gas service checks to verify capacity for new equipment, and identification of any panel upgrades or new gas line requirements.

Equipment selection: what to consider

  • Efficiency ratings: look for furnaces with high AFUE or heat pumps with high HSPF/SEER to maximize energy savings in La Habra’s climate.
  • Right-sizing: capacity should match the Manual J results. Oversizing reduces comfort and increases wear.
  • Fuel type and heat source: assess whether a gas furnace, electric heat pump, or hybrid solution (furnace + heat pump) best meets your comfort needs, budget, and local incentive opportunities.
  • Indoor air quality features: upgraded filtration, UV lights, and humidity control can improve comfort in homes with dust or pollen issues common in the region.

Ductwork evaluation and upgrades

  • Inspect and measure existing ducts for leaks, pressure imbalances, and insulation levels, especially for attic and crawlspace runs.
  • Recommended upgrades may include sealing with mastic or aerosol sealing, adding or resizing returns, insulating ducts exposed to unconditioned spaces, and balancing dampers for even distribution.
  • Proper airflow is essential for efficiency and system longevity. Correct ductwork prevents issues that often appear after a new unit is installed.

Typical installation timeline

  • Residential heating installations vary by system complexity:
  • Straight furnace swap with existing ductwork: typically 1 day for removal and install, plus inspections as required.
  • Heat pump or mini-split installation with minor modifications: 1–3 days.
  • Full system replacement with significant ductwork changes or gas/electrical upgrades: 2–5 days, plus permit and inspection lead times.
  • Unforeseen issues uncovered during the site survey (e.g., rotten plenum, inadequate gas pipe, or inaccessible attic) can add time; a thorough survey helps minimize surprises.

Safety checks and commissioning checklist

  • Combustion safety: draft and CO testing for gas furnaces, verification of proper venting and clearances.
  • Refrigerant and electrical checks: refrigerant charge verification, amp draw, and voltage confirmation for heat pumps.
  • Airflow verification: temperature rise tests for furnaces, airflow CFM checks, and duct leakage testing where applicable.
  • Controls and thermostat calibration: confirm setpoints, schedule programming, and sensor operation.
  • Final walk-through: explain operation, filter locations, service items, and document system settings and warranty information.
